The Oregon Department of Administrative Services shall control and supervise the acquisition, installation and use of all electronic or automatic data processing equipment to be used primarily for the purposes of the accounting records and system referred to in ORS 293.590. The adequacy and capacity of that equipment for purposes of the performance of constitutional functions of the Secretary of State as Auditor of Public Accounts shall be as determined by and under the control of the Secretary of State. The department shall authorize use of that equipment for other purposes to the extent that use for those other purposes does not conflict with use for the primary purpose of the accounting records and system.
